Caved a week ago. Got the 512GB in indigo. Here are my thoughts.
512GB wasn't really a question. I go through storage fast and didn't want to be deleting files six months in. Same with Touch ID, wasn't giving that up. Typing your password every time feels regressive once you've gone without it.
Wanted the silver one originally but it was sold out everywhere near me, so it was indigo or green, and green's a little loud for my taste. Ended up liking indigo way more than I expected. Pictures make it look brighter than it is, in person it's pretty muted. I just wish the keyboard was lighter (a bit too dark IMO).
I'm coming from a MacBook Pro, M1 Pro chip, 14-inch 2021. Used it with zero issues for five years (though a tad overpowered for my needs). The problem was weight. I travel a lot for work and lugging it through airports on top of a full bag wore on me after a while.
The Neo fixed that. It's lighter to a degree that's almost funny. I checked my bag the first day thinking I'd left it at home. Noticeable difference on travel days specifically.
My only real gripe is the non-backlit keyboard. I write a lot at night. Been getting around it by switching to light mode after dark, and it's also pushed me to stop looking down at the keys while I type.
I work in marketing, so this thing gets used constantly, and I'm traveling something like twice a month right now. I love this computer.
